linux关闭防火墙的命令行

worktile 其他 93

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Linux系统中,可以使用命令行来关闭防火墙。不同的Linux发行版可能使用不同的防火墙软件,比如iptables、ufw等,所以关闭防火墙的具体命令也会有所不同。

    下面是一些常见的Linux发行版中关闭防火墙的命令行示例:

    1. Ubuntu和Debian系列:
    “`
    sudo ufw disable
    “`

    2. CentOS和RHEL系列:
    “`
    sudo systemctl stop firewalld
    sudo systemctl disable firewalld
    “`

    3. Fedora:
    “`
    sudo systemctl stop firewalld
    sudo systemctl disable firewalld
    “`

    4. Arch Linux:
    “`
    sudo systemctl stop iptables
    sudo systemctl disable iptables
    “`

    请注意,在关闭防火墙之前要确保你的系统网络环境相对安全,因为关闭防火墙可能会导致系统暴露在网络攻击的风险中。关闭防火墙仅适用于特定的测试环境或特殊需求,正常情况下还是建议保持防火墙开启以确保系统的安全性。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ux系统中,关闭防火墙可以通过命令行执行以下步骤:

    1. 确认防火墙状态:
    使用以下命令确认当前防火墙的状态:
    “`
    sudo ufw status
    “`

    该命令将显示防火墙的状态信息,包括启用、禁用和当前开放的端口列表。

    2. 关闭防火墙:
    如果防火墙状态为启用,可以使用以下命令关闭防火墙:
    “`
    sudo ufw disable
    “`

    执行此命令后,防火墙将被禁用。

    3. 确认防火墙已关闭:
    再次使用以下命令确认防火墙是否已关闭:
    “`
    sudo ufw status
    “`

    如果输出结果显示防火墙状态为“inactive”,则表示防火墙已成功关闭。

    4. 永久禁用防火墙:
    上述步骤只是在当前会话中关闭了防火墙,系统重启后防火墙可能会重新启用。如果希望永久禁用防火墙,需要编辑防火墙配置文件。

    可以使用以下命令打开该配置文件:
    “`
    sudo nano /etc/ufw/ufw.conf
    “`

    在该文件的`ENABLED`行处修改值为`no`,然后保存并关闭该文件。

    最后,重新启动系统以使更改生效。

    5. 其他方式关闭防火墙:
    如果不使用ufw防火墙管理工具,还可以使用其他方式关闭防火墙。

    – 如果使用iptables作为防火墙,可以使用以下命令全部清空iptables规则,实现关闭防火墙:
    “`
    sudo iptables -F
    “`

    – 如果使用firewalld作为防火墙,可以使用以下命令停止并禁用firewalld服务:
    “`
    sudo systemctl stop firewalld
    sudo systemctl disable firewalld
    “`

    需要注意的是,关闭防火墙将会导致系统更容易受到网络攻击,请谨慎操作并确保其他安全措施已经到位。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ux系统中,关闭防火墙可以使用以下命令行操作。

    1. iptables命令:
    iptables是Linux系统中用来配置防火墙规则的工具,可以通过以下命令关闭防火墙:
    “`shell
    sudo iptables -F # 清除防火墙规则
    sudo iptables -X # 删除用户自定义链
    sudo iptables -Z # 清除所有计数器和包的计数器

    sudo iptables -P INPUT ACCEPT # 所有输入包都接受
    sudo iptables -P FORWARD ACCEPT # 所有转发包都接受
    sudo iptables -P OUTPUT ACCEPT # 所有输出包都接受
    “`
    上述命令中,先通过`-F`选项清除所有防火墙规则,然后通过`-X`选项删除所有用户自定义链,最后通过`-Z`选项清除计数器和包的计数器。最后三条命令是用来将默认策略设置为接受所有输入、转发和输出包。

    2. UFW命令:
    UFW(Uncomplicated Firewall)是ubuntu系统中的防火墙配置工具,可以使用以下命令关闭防火墙:
    “`shell
    sudo ufw disable
    “`
    该命令会将UFW防火墙停用,相当于关闭防火墙。

    3. firewalld命令:
    firewalld是CentOS和Fedora系统中的防火墙管理工具,可以使用以下命令关闭防火墙:
    “`shell
    sudo systemctl stop firewalld.service # 停止firewalld服务
    sudo systemctl disable firewalld.service # 禁用firewalld服务
    “`
    第一条命令是停止firewalld服务,即关闭防火墙;第二条命令是禁用firewalld服务,使其禁止在系统启动时自动运行。

    注意:关闭防火墙可能会导致系统的安全性降低,建议在必要情况下才关闭防火墙,关闭期间需要注意网络安全。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部